2019 AMC 12B Problem 2

Problem 2 of 25EasierNumber Theory

Consider the statement, “If nn is not prime, then n2n-2 is prime.” Which of the following values of nn is a counterexample to this statement?

Solution

A counterexample needs nn not prime (so the hypothesis holds) and n2n-2 not prime (so the conclusion fails). Among the choices, 2727 is not prime and 272=2527-2=25 is not prime. The primes 1111 and 1919 fail the hypothesis, and 152=13,15-2=13, 212=1921-2=19 are prime. Thus, E is the correct answer.
